On Thu, Apr 16, 2026 at 1:57 PM Richard Biener <[email protected]> wrote: > > I was interested to exercise opportunities, exposed by bbro pass (as > > mentioned in [1]), so the natural place to put the new pass is after > > bbro pass: > > > > On x86_32, IRA zeroes %ecx, which is later copied to %eax in the > > terminal basic block: > > > > 12: NOTE_INSN_BASIC_BLOCK 3 > > 7: cx:SI=0 > > REG_EQUAL 0 > > 45: pc=L36 > > ... > > 36: L36: > > 39: NOTE_INSN_BASIC_BLOCK 7 > > 37: ax:SI=cx:SI > > 38: use ax:SI > > > > This sequence is reordered in bbro pass to: > > > > 28: L28: > > 12: NOTE_INSN_BASIC_BLOCK 7 > > 69: {cx:SI=0;clobber flags:CC;} > > REG_UNUSED flags:CC > > 71: ax:SI=cx:SI > > REG_DEAD cx:SI > > 72: use ax:SI > > 73: NOTE_INSN_EPILOGUE_BEG > > 74: bx:SI=[sp:SI++] > > REG_CFA_ADJUST_CFA sp:SI=sp:SI+0x4 > > REG_CFA_RESTORE bx:SI > > 75: si:SI=[sp:SI++] > > REG_CFA_ADJUST_CFA sp:SI=sp:SI+0x4 > > REG_CFA_RESTORE si:SI > > 76: simple_return > > Ah, so maybe we can have a late combine entry that can be invoked > iff BB reorder does any path duplication only? On GIMPLE we > increasingly invoke pass workers directly from other passes > in such case, VN even has a mode to operate on small portions > of the CFG. Please also note that with the i386 testcase, even before bbro pass there is in _.c.350r.rtl_dce: 25: L25: 18: NOTE_INSN_BASIC_BLOCK 5 19: cx:SI=ax:SI 20: flags:CCZ=cmp([ax:SI],si:SI) 21: pc={(flags:CCZ==0)?L36:pc} REG_DEAD flags:CCZ REG_BR_PROB 59055801 22: NOTE_INSN_BASIC_BLOCK 6 23: {dx:SI=dx:SI+0x1;clobber flags:CC;} REG_UNUSED flags:CC 24: {ax:SI=ax:SI+0x4;clobber flags:CC;} REG_UNUSED flags:CC 26: flags:CCZ=cmp(bx:SI,dx:SI) 27: pc={(flags:CCZ!=0)?L25:pc} REG_DEAD flags:CCZ REG_BR_PROB 1014686025 47: NOTE_INSN_BASIC_BLOCK 7 48: pc=L28 49: barrier 36: L36: 39: NOTE_INSN_BASIC_BLOCK 8 37: ax:SI=cx:SI REG_DEAD cx:SI 38: use ax:SI (insn 19) and (insn 37) are also detected by pass_late_combine as redundant. So, the pass should run even if BB reorder doesn't duplicate paths to optimize some opportunities, exposed by previous passes. Uros.
